The committee had been set up to study the problems faced by the Malayalam film industry and provide suggestions to revamp the sector. Balan has said that the State government is contemplating to bring in a legislation to promote and safeguard the Malayalam film industry. The project would be envisaged by the Kerala State Film Development Corporation. Plans are afoot to set up 100 government cinema halls in rural, semi-rural and urban areas. But this was not the case for all since the State-owned 14 cinema halls had made a profit of Rs 4.75 crore last year, “ he said.
